WHO WE ARE

We are a video production and digital marketing agency based in Newry, County Down. Chapter House was founded in September 2011 by Mark Byrne, a college lecturer, technology consultant and Doctoral Candidate at Queen’s University, Belfast. Mark’s experience includes a role as Trainee Assistant Director on Season 7 of HBO’s Game of Thrones.

Carols from Newry City

Carols from Newry City was a special hour-long musical broadcast for Christmas 2021, featuring musical performances from every secondary school in Newry and musical groups perfuming in a range of venues across the city. ‘Carols from Newry City’ was broadcast simultaneously on the Newry Cathedral Webcam and Newry Cathedral Parish YouTube channel on Sunday 13th December 2020.

Palm Sunday Night Prayer

A special musical Broadcast for Dromore Diocese, recorded at Saint Colman’s College, Newry and broadcast on Palm Sunday 2021.

Stations of The Cross from Dromantine

A Special outdoor broadcast from Dromore Diocese from Dromantine with Archbishop Eamon Martin, Catholic Primate of All Ireland and young people from the diocese. Broadcast on Good Friday 2021.
